#4b7142 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b7142 is composed of 29.4% red, 44.3%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.6%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 108.5 degrees, a saturation of 26.3% and a lightness of 35.1%. #4b7142 color hex could be obtained by blending #96e284 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#4b7142 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b7142 has RGB values of R:75, G:113,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 4944194.
